Mooncrest Neighborhood Programs
Mooncrest Neighborhood Programs was founded in 2002 by Sr. Renee Procopio to serve the children of the Mooncrest neighborhood. MNP has grown to include a wide range of programs and services for children, adults, and families and carries on in the Felician spirit to “serve where needed”. MNP continues to address unmet community needs through afterschool and summer programming for youth, food access programs, family support programs, and access to health and maternal health services through strong and vibrant community partnerships. Mooncrest Neighborhood Programs is a program of Hopebound Ministries, Inc., which is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it corporation sponsored by the Congregation of the Sisters of St. Felix of Cantalice, Our Lady of Hope Province (“Felician Sisters”).
Hopebound Ministries supports emerging social service programs founded by Felician Sisters. Hopebound equips sustainable, deeply rooted programs instilled with the Felician Core Values as we collaborate to promote flourishing in the communities we serve. Felician Sisters of North America
The Felician Sisters of North America are a congregation of women religious, inspired by the spiritual ideals of their Foundress Blessed Mary Angela Truszkowska and Saint Francis of Assisi. The Felician Sisters live in community, dedicating their lives to God and the Church—always striving to live and share the Gospel message through lives of prayer and service as they cooperate with Christ in the spiritual renewal of the world. Pioneers of social services, the Felician Sisters sponsor more than 32 ministries throughout North American and Haiti and continue to "serve where you are needed" as Blessed Mary Angela called on them to do.
